        <p>A new approach to solving the problems of detecting and determining the parameters of chirp signals based on the instantaneous flow of additional processing of the spectra obtained by FFT, which provides compensation for the distributed and lumped station noise and fluctuation noise, which is based on finding the cross correlation of the instantaneous spectra with each other, the allocation vector-variable, obtaining the average spectrum of the analyzed frames.</p>
